Today, Cage The Elephant debuts their new music video for “Social Cues,” with band performance taped at Adult Swim’s FishCenter Live in Atlanta, GA, and additional direction by singer Matt Shultz. The video for their latest single provides the phone number 615-235-5440 and encourages fans to text the band directly, who will be responding to questions and elaborating on the themes of their album, Social Cues. Cage The Elephant will also join Instagram Live throughout the day to debut a series of deconstructed videos showing the evolution of the “Social Cues” music video. Social Cues” marks the 9th #1 song on the Alternative Radio chart for the band, following their first single from the album, “Ready To Let Go,” which scored the band its best airplay chart debut in its near-decade career. Cage The Elephant has achieved more #1s at the format than any band this decade.

The band just wrapped up their two-month long amphitheater “The Night Running Tour” with Beck featuring Spoon in the US. The band announced a UK & European tour in early 2020 that also features SWMRS and Post Animal, and will close out the year with performances in DC, New York City, and Chicago.
